Hi All,

Looking for some information on the dual glass cockpit set up.

I have 2 Garmin 10” in my new R4 that I’ll be picking up.

I know from the dealer it is set up to have the chart plotter / navigation non the left screen and the boat information and controls on the right screen (gages, light color control, rear video camera, etc.

99% of the time by boat will be used on a lake where I will not at all need the navigation. Does the left side have to be navigation or can it also be used for boat information. As an example…If I wanted to have rear camera showing of the left screen and boat gages showing on the right screen. Or if I want to have the boat gages on the left screen vs. the right screen?

I’m just trying to understand how much control I can have as far as the content on each screen. It would suck to have a whole screen that is not used since navigation features ogre not needed on the lake.

Thanks for any information!

Very customizable, it isn't easy but once it is setup the way you want it, then it is easy to keep it that way. Give yourself a good hour to learn it.

They are both identical displays that can both be set up for whatever you want. Nav on both, engine data on both, it doesn't matter.
